What Is a Single Pin Sight and How Does It Work for a Compound Bow?

A single pin sight is a type of bow sight designed to improve accuracy by providing a clear and simplified aiming point. Unlike multi-pin sights that have several sight pins for various distances, a single pin sight focuses on one adjustable pin, allowing archers to set their aim for different yardages.

How It Works:

  • Adjustment: The single pin can be adjusted vertically for different distances. This is typically done using a knob or dial that moves the pin up or down, allowing the archer to align the pin with the target’s distance.
  • Precision: The simplicity of having one pin minimizes confusion and allows for precise aiming. When the archer sets the distance based on the target, they can concentrate solely on that one point.
  • Clear Sight Picture: With just one pin, the sight picture is less cluttered, making it easier to focus on the target rather than multiple aiming points.

What Features Make a Single Pin Sight Stand Out?

The best single pin sights for compound bows stand out due to a combination of precision, adjustability, and durability.

  • Precision Pin Adjustment: A high-quality single pin sight offers precise pin adjustment, allowing archers to fine-tune their aim for different distances with ease. This feature enhances accuracy by enabling users to set their sight for specific yardages without the clutter of multiple pins.
  • Micro-Adjustment Capability: Many top models come with micro-adjustment knobs that allow for minute changes in both windage and elevation. This level of adjustability ensures that even the slightest variations in shot placement can be corrected, making it ideal for competitive shooting.
  • Lightweight and Compact Design: The best single pin sights are designed to be lightweight and compact, which helps maintain the overall balance of the bow. This is particularly beneficial for hunters who need to carry their equipment over long distances without added bulk.
  • Durable Construction: A standout feature of quality single pin sights is their durable construction, often made from aluminum or other robust materials. This ensures they can withstand the rigors of outdoor conditions, including rain and rough handling, while maintaining their accuracy.
  • Tool-less Adjustments: Many of the best single pin sights allow for tool-less adjustments, making it easy for archers to make changes in the field without needing specialized tools. This convenience is particularly useful during hunting trips where quick adaptations may be necessary.
  • Light Gathering Features: Some models incorporate light gathering technology, such as fiber optics, to enhance visibility in low-light conditions. This feature ensures that the sight pin is easily visible, allowing for effective shooting during dawn or dusk.
  • Easy Setup and Calibration: The best single pin sights often come with straightforward instructions for setup and calibration, making them accessible for beginners. A user-friendly setup process allows archers to quickly get their sights dialed in and focus on improving their shooting technique.

How Does Durability Impact Your Choice of Sight?

When selecting a single pin sight for a compound bow, durability is a key factor that influences your choice. A sight must withstand the rigors of outdoor use, including varying weather conditions and potential impacts during hunting or target practice. Durable materials enhance the sight’s lifespan and performance under stress.

Consider the following elements when evaluating durability:

  • Construction Material: Sights made from aluminum or high-grade polymers tend to offer superior resistance to wear and corrosion compared to plastic alternatives. For instance, aluminum sights often exhibit greater sturdiness, maintaining alignment even after rough handling.

  • Weather Resistance: Look for sights with weatherproof coatings or finishes that provide protection against rust and damage from rain or moisture. This is particularly important for hunters who often face unpredictable weather.

  • Glass Quality: If the sight includes lenses, ensure they are made from scratch-resistant glass. High-quality optics can prevent fogging and scratching, ensuring consistent performance.

  • Mechanical Stability: A well-constructed adjustment mechanism will retain zero even after repeated shots. Check for reliable locking systems that secure adjustments against accidental shifts.

Investing in a durable sight not only enhances accuracy but also gives peace of mind knowing that your equipment can withstand challenging conditions.

What Are the Advantages of Using a Single Pin Sight for Archery?

The advantages of using a single pin sight for archery include precision, simplicity, and reduced weight, making it a popular choice among compound bow users.

  • Precision: A single pin sight allows for more accurate aiming as it eliminates the clutter of multiple pins, enabling the archer to focus solely on the target. This can lead to improved shot consistency and better overall performance, especially at varying distances.
  • Simplicity: With only one pin to adjust and align, single pin sights simplify the shooting process. Archers can quickly make adjustments for different distances without the distraction of multiple pins, which can be beneficial in high-pressure situations or when time is limited.
  • Reduced Weight: Single pin sights are typically lighter than multi-pin models, which can be an important factor for archers who prioritize mobility and ease of use. This lightweight design can enhance overall shooting comfort and reduce fatigue during long shooting sessions or while hunting.
  • Customization: Many single pin sights offer adjustable yardage settings, allowing archers to set the pin for specific distances, which is especially useful for long-range shooting. This feature enables users to fine-tune their sighting system according to their shooting preferences and conditions.
  • Enhanced Visibility: The lack of multiple pins can lead to better visibility of the target and the surrounding area. This is especially advantageous in low-light conditions or when shooting at game, as the single pin draws less attention and makes it easier to see other vital elements in the environment.

How Should You Install a Single Pin Sight on Your Compound Bow?

Installing a single pin sight on your compound bow requires careful consideration and precise execution to ensure optimal performance.

  • Gather Necessary Tools: Before beginning the installation, ensure you have all required tools at hand, such as a screwdriver, Allen wrenches, and a bow vise if available.
  • Remove the Existing Sight: Carefully detach the current sight from your bow, taking note of its position and any reference points to aid in the new installation.
  • Position the New Sight: Align the new single pin sight on the bow’s sight mounting area, ensuring it is level and securely positioned for accurate aiming.
  • Secure the Sight: Tighten all screws and bolts to firmly attach the sight to the bow, being careful not to overtighten which could damage the sight or bow.
  • Calibrate the Sight: Adjust the pin for elevation and windage, and conduct a paper tuning test to ensure it is properly sighted in for your specific shooting distance.
  • Test the Sight: Finally, take your bow to a range to test the sight under various conditions, making any necessary adjustments based on your shooting experience.

Gathering necessary tools ensures that you have everything required for the installation process, which can save time and prevent interruptions. Common tools include a screwdriver for screwing in the sight and Allen wrenches for tightening bolts.

The removal of the existing sight is crucial as it provides a clean slate for the new installation. It’s important to take note of how the old sight was positioned, as this can help with aligning the new sight correctly.

When positioning the new sight, it is essential to ensure it is level to avoid any aiming inaccuracies. A properly aligned sight will enhance your ability to hit targets at various distances.

Securing the sight properly involves tightening all screws and bolts to prevent any movement during use. It’s important to strike a balance—tight enough to stay in place, but not so tight that it risks damage.

Calibrating the sight is a crucial step, as it ensures that the pin corresponds to the actual distance to your target. A well-calibrated sight will improve your shooting accuracy and confidence.

Testing the sight at a range allows you to evaluate its performance in real conditions and make any final adjustments. This practical assessment is vital for ensuring that you are comfortable and effective with your new sight setup.
